True or False:
1. A convex mirror can form an enlarged image. — False
2. A concave mirror can form both erect and inverted images. — True
3. Lenses allow light to pass through them. — True
4. The angle of reflection is always smaller than the angle of incidence. — False
5. Convex lenses converge light rays. — True
6. Concave lenses can burn paper by focusing sunlight. — False
7. Plane mirrors always produce laterally inverted images. — True
8. The normal is drawn at 45° to the mirror surface. — False
9. A convex mirror provides a smaller, wider view of objects behind. — True
10. The human eye has a concave lens. — False
